Factors to Consider When Choosing Best Wireless Video Transmitters For Studios

When choosing a wireless video transmitter for a studio, it’s important to consider several key factors beyond just specs. Understanding these considerations helps prevent common pitfalls like overspending on unnecessary features or selecting incompatible equipment. A well-chosen transmitter enhances your production flow, so taking the time to evaluate your needs ensures a smoother setup and better results.

Range and Coverage Area

Range determines how freely you can move around your studio without losing signal. Smaller setups might get away with 100-300ft, but larger studios or outdoor shoots need models with 500ft or more. Keep in mind, longer-range units often introduce higher latency or require more powerful antennas. Assess your space carefully to avoid buying a transmitter that’s either overkill or insufficient for your environment.

Latency and Real-Time Performance

Latency impacts how synchronized your video feed is with real-time action. For live production or streaming, low latency (under 0.1 seconds) is essential to prevent delays. However, ultra-low latency models may sacrifice range or increase complexity. Balance your need for immediacy with the scale of your setup to avoid lag that disrupts your workflow.

Video Quality and Resolution

Most studio setups require at least 1080p transmission, but 4K-capable models are increasingly common. Higher resolutions demand better compression and hardware, which can add cost. Consider your end-use—broadcast, streaming, or recording—and select a transmitter that consistently delivers clear, stable images without artifacts or signal dropouts.

Compatibility and Device Support

Make sure the transmitter works seamlessly with your cameras, computers, or smartphones. Some models support only HDMI, while others include USB-C or SDI inputs. Versatile units that support multiple input types can future-proof your setup and reduce the need for additional adapters or converters, saving time and money.

Ease of Setup and Reliability

Ease of installation varies widely—plug-and-play options can speed up setup, but may lack advanced features. Reliability under different conditions, interference resistance, and stability are equally important, especially in busy studio environments. Reading user reviews and considering manufacturer support can help you choose a transmitter that stays consistent over time.

Frequently Asked Questions

Can I use a wireless video transmitter for live streaming without noticeable delay?

Yes, many wireless transmitters offer low latency options specifically designed for live streaming, often under 0.1 seconds. Selecting a model with this feature ensures your video remains synchronized with live action, preventing noticeable lag. However, keep in mind that the actual delay can still be influenced by your network environment and device compatibility, so choosing a transmitter with proven low latency is key for smooth live streams.

Will a longer-range wireless transmitter cause significant latency or quality loss?

Longer-range units often introduce some tradeoffs, such as increased latency or slight quality degradation, especially if using lower-quality hardware or over congested frequencies. Many high-end models mitigate these issues with advanced antennas and signal processing. To balance range with performance, consider your specific needs—if you require extensive coverage but minimal latency, investing in a premium model with specialized features is advisable.

Are wireless transmitters compatible with all types of cameras and devices?

Compatibility varies; most wireless HDMI transmitters support standard HDMI outputs, which are common in cameras and computers. However, some devices use different outputs like SDI or USB-C, requiring adapters or specific models. Checking each transmitter’s input options and supported resolutions ensures seamless integration with your existing equipment, reducing setup frustrations.

How does interference affect wireless video transmission in a studio?

Interference from Wi-Fi networks, Bluetooth devices, or other wireless equipment can disrupt signal quality and cause dropouts. Many transmitters operate on 5GHz bands, which are less crowded but still susceptible to interference. To maintain stable feeds, consider models with adaptive frequency hopping or interference mitigation features, and always test your setup in the intended environment before critical shoots.

Is it worth paying more for 4K support in a wireless transmitter?

Paying extra for 4K support makes sense if your workflow involves high-resolution content, such as professional broadcasting or detailed post-production work. However, higher resolutions demand better hardware, lower latency, and more bandwidth, which can increase costs. For casual or lower-budget productions, 1080p models often suffice, but investing in 4K-capable transmitters future-proofs your setup as your needs grow.
